### Display

With a 17.3-inch screen boasting a 16:9 aspect ratio and a 2560 x 1440 pixel resolution, the Aorus 17X AZG offers a vast and clear display, ideal for immersive gaming sessions. It’s worth noting that the screen is non-glossy and supports a high refresh rate of 240 Hz, ensuring smooth visuals even during rapid motion scenes.

### Connectivity

This laptop is well-equipped in terms of connections, featuring three USB 3.1 Gen2 ports, a Thunderbolt port for high-speed data transfers, an HDMI port for external displays, and a 3.5mm audio socket for headphones or speakers.

### Networking

For internet and network connections, the Aorus 17X AZG comes with a 10/100/1000 LAN card and supports Wi-Fi standards up to Wi-Fi 6 (802.11 a/b/g/n/ac/ax), alongside Bluetooth 5.2 compatibility for wireless peripheral connectivity.

### Size, Weight, and Build

The device measures 21.8 mm in height, 396 mm in width, and 293 mm in depth, which is relatively compact for a device of its class. Weighing in at 2.8 kg, it’s evident that this laptop prioritizes performance and screen size over portability.

### Performance Hardware

Deep diving into the muscles of this system, we find the N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4090 Laptop GPU, a top-tier graphics card based on the Ada Lovelace architecture, carrying 16 GB GDDR6 VRAM and boasting a memory bus of 256 Bit. The GPU can handle the most graphically intense games effortlessly, enabling high resolution and detailed settings along with Anti-Aliasing for a smooth graphical experience.

The heart of this gaming titan is the high-end mobile i9-14900HX processor hailing from the Raptor Lake architecture, which packs 24 cores and 32 threads, reaching clock speeds of up to 5.8 GHz.

### Operating System and Camera

Out of the box, the system runs Microsoft Windows 11 Home, enhancing the gaming and user experience with the latest features from the operating system. For video calls and streaming, an integrated IR webcam with a 2 MP resolution is included.
